Solar and wind energy are the most affordable sources of electricity

Solar and wind energy are now the most affordable sources of new electricity in 82% of the world, according to a recent study by RMI. This is largely due to the rising costs of fossil fuels, which have been impacted by the war in Ukraine and wholesale prices.

Solar PV became the most affordable renewable energy in history in 2021, after it became cheaper than gas. Onshore and offshore wind are also among the cheapest sources of renewable energy. In 2023, the IEA reported that 96% of newly installed, utility-scale solar PV and onshore wind capacity had lower generation costs than new coal and natural gas. Three-quarters of these new wind and solar plants offered cheaper power than existing fossil fuel facilities.

The cost of renewable technologies has been decreasing since 2010 due to technological advancements and economies of scale. The price of solar energy is expected to fall by half by 2030, and wind energy by a quarter, according to a report by clean energy think tank RMI. Fossil fuels are subsidised by governments, clean energy less so

The cost of energy is a complex issue, with many factors influencing the price paid by consumers. One significant factor is the role of government subsidies, which can distort the true cost of energy and influence the adoption of clean energy technologies.

Fossil fuels have long been subsidised by governments worldwide, with these subsidies often taking the form of tax breaks, direct funding for research and development, and price caps. In 2023, governments collectively spent around $620 billion subsidising fossil fuels, compared to just $70 billion on consumer-facing clean energy investments. This disparity is significant and influences the relative costs of fossil fuels and clean energy for consumers.

The reasons for subsidising fossil fuels are varied. Historically, fossil fuel subsidies have aimed to promote cheap and abundant energy, which has contributed to economic growth. However, this has led to inefficient behaviour, with consumers burning more fossil fuels and contributing to climate pollution. Additionally, fossil fuel subsidies disproportionately benefit higher-income households, hindering growth and contributing to social inequities.

On the other hand, clean energy subsidies are often implemented to level the playing field and make renewable energy sources more cost-competitive. These subsidies can take the form of investments in research and development, tax credits for utilities or consumers, and requirements for a certain percentage of energy to come from renewable sources. While these subsidies have been successful in some cases, such as with solar and wind energy, the overall investment in clean energy transitions lags due to real or perceived risks and access to finance.

To accelerate the transition to clean energy and reduce the cost for consumers, policy interventions are crucial. This includes phasing out inefficient fossil fuel subsidies, implementing carbon pricing mechanisms, and providing targeted support for vulnerable communities. By addressing the stark inequalities in the current energy system, countries can promote sustainable and equitable outcomes while driving down the costs of clean energy technologies.

Clean energy creates more jobs

Clean energy is cheaper than fossil fuels, and this is only set to continue as renewable energy becomes more affordable. In 2023, an estimated 96% of newly installed, utility-scale solar PV and onshore wind capacity had lower generation costs than new coal and natural gas.

This is good news for the global economy, and it is also positive for employment. Clean energy creates more jobs than fossil fuels. A broad government study found that renewable energy creates 4.3 times as many jobs as coal and 5.4 times as many as natural gas. The ongoing shift to clean energy is, therefore, beneficial for employment and workers.

In the US, there are now more jobs in solar power than in oil, gas, or coal extraction. This is reflected in the statistics, which show that from 2014 to 2015, solar employment increased by 6%, while employment in upstream oil and gas and support services dropped by 18%. This is due to the falling consumption of coal and the continued reduction in labor intensity.

Clean energy jobs are also generally of higher quality and are more distributed. The American Clean Power Association (ACP) reported that clean energy manufacturing contributes $18 billion to GDP, attracts $33 billion in domestic investment, and supports 122,000 jobs. Clean energy provides direct employment for over 460,000 Americans.
